First make sure it is a 6s plus. On the back of the phone on the bottom it will have a small "s" under the "iPhone" letters. If it does not have an "s", it is just a regular iphone 6 plus. Which is good news because the LCDs for iphone 6 plus are way cheaper then iphone 6s plus (yes the 2 LCD's are different, its so stupid). When you buy the LCD, make sure they have a good return policy as well, just in case your IC chip is damaged, you can return the screen and not lose any money.
